To understand the significance of this qualifier, we must first establish the context of the IEM (Intel Extreme Masters) ecosystem. IEM is not just a tournament; it is a globally recognized brand under ESL, representing the apex of professional FPS (First-Person Shooter) competition. The Beijing 2026 qualifiers serve as a critical gateway, funneling the region’s top talent into the global stage. The term "4K" itself is a quantified metric of skill—four eliminations in rapid succession, a feat that requires not only mechanical precision but also cognitive processing speed and tactical foresight. Business Model Analysis: Revenue Streams and Economic Sustainability

The business model of esports is a multi-layered construct built on media rights, sponsorship, and merchandise. IEM’s success is predicated on its ability to attract global brands willing to invest in its audience. The Beijing event is not just a competition; it is a commercial venture designed to generate revenue through viewership and engagement. The 4K performed by Flouzer is a marketing asset, a highlight reel that can be repurposed across social media platforms to drive further interest.

ARPPU (Average Revenue Per Paying User) in this context is less about direct consumer payments and more about the value of audience attention. Advertisers are willing to pay a premium for access to the demographics that engage with FPS content. The sustainability of this model depends on the continued growth of the viewer base and the ability of organizers to deliver consistent, high-quality broadcasts.

The potential risk lies in the over-reliance on key sponsors. If major brands withdraw, the financial structure of the event could collapse. Technology Platform Analysis: Infrastructure as Competitive Advantage

The technological infrastructure supporting esports is a critical enabler of the experience. High-speed internet, low-latency servers, and professional broadcasting equipment are essential for delivering a seamless viewing experience. The use of LAN environments for qualifiers ensures fairness and minimizes the impact of external variables on the outcome.

The integration of AI and data analytics is becoming increasingly prevalent in esports. Teams use these tools to analyze opponent strategies, optimize their own play, and even predict match outcomes. This technological edge can be the difference between victory and defeat.

The challenge lies in accessibility and standardization. Smaller teams may lack the resources to invest in advanced technology, creating a barrier to entry and potentially skewing competition. Ensuring a level playing field is essential for the long-term health of the ecosystem.
